How they compare

Tonga currently reports 0.2% against 0.1% in Poland, a difference of 0.1%.

That makes Tonga's figure about 2.0 times Poland's.

The two have swapped places 1 time across 6 shared years of data; in 2003 it was Tonga ahead.

Poland ranks 116th and Tonga ranks 114th of 134 countries.
